Paragoniates is a monospecific genus of freshwater ray-finned fish belonging to the family Characidae. The only species in the genus is Paragoniates alburnus, a characin which is found in the Amazon River basin in Brazil, Bolivia, Peru and Venezuela. References Froese, Rainer; Pauly, Daniel (eds.)
